## LiftSim: simulator stuck in "dispatch loop"

If the VertiFlow dashboard shows LiftSim cars bouncing between floors 3 and 7 forever, the scenario queue has probably deadlocked. First, pause the scenario runner, then flush the pending-call table with `liftsim flush --soft`. If cars still won't settle within two minutes, restart the dispatch worker — it's safe, state is checkpointed. Full recovery steps are on the internal page.

dashboard of yafog-fajof = https://jira.tolvaqsys.internal/pages/pages/projects/49fe21c4

The Orvane Labs bike cage and the east and west parking gates operate on separate access schedules, and facilities desk staff should note that visitor vehicles may only use the west gate between 07:00 and 19:00. Cyclists requesting cage access must show a valid day pass, and their details should be entered in the access ledger before the cage is opened. Gates must never be propped open, even briefly, during deliveries. When a manual override is required at either gate, use the code below.

staff pass of fadup-fawig = bdg-FUNKS-4

Subject: Customer-concentration risk — Ardwick account

Team,

I want to flag something carefully. The Ardwick Fabrication account now represents 38% of quarterly revenue, up from 24% last year. If their Lorring Valley plant consolidates suppliers — and there are signals it might — we face a serious gap. Sales leads should begin mapping expansion targets in the mid-market segment and avoid further deepening Ardwick dependence without executive sign-off. Our response strategy is outlined in the confidential note below.

confidential, bahap-bajog: Zorethix Works is in early talks to buy Kelethox Foods for about $30.7 million. The Ralvan launch date is September 19, and nothing goes to the press before then.

Subject: Partner SFTP drop — new owner

Hi,

As you review the pending changes to the Harborline ingest scripts, note that ownership of the partner SFTP drop is changing at the end of the month. This includes key rotation, the nightly pull job, and the quarantine folder for malformed files. Review comments on the retry logic should still go through the normal PR flow, but questions about drop-folder conventions or partner onboarding now go to the new owner. The incoming owner is listed below.

signatory, tagaf-bahaf: Praael Fenmir Rusok